Skip to content

Fix annotation error in gold_reference.jsonl line 503#8

Open
Copilot wants to merge 3 commits into
masterfrom
copilot/fix-annotation-error-dataset
Open

Fix annotation error in gold_reference.jsonl line 503#8
Copilot wants to merge 3 commits into
masterfrom
copilot/fix-annotation-error-dataset

Conversation

Copy link
Copy Markdown

Copilot AI commented Oct 9, 2025

Problem

Line 503 in data/gold_reference.jsonl contained a critical data annotation error where the meta_timeline field had events from a completely unrelated topic.

The main timeline is about 金晓钟金泫雅恋情 (Kim Hyuna and Dawn's relationship, ID: 1022), but the meta_timeline['5'] incorrectly contained events about 河南一女孩实名举报父亲被打死后失联 (the Ye Hongqing case in Henan, ID: 19841).

Example of the Error

{
  "title": "金晓钟金泫雅恋情",
  "id": 1022,
  "timeline": [
    {"id": 5, "summary": "泫雅金晓钟将合体出道", ...}
  ],
  "meta_timeline": {
    "5": {
      "timeline": [
        {"id": 0, "summary": "杞县公安局通报:村民叶洪青被打死 犯罪嫌疑人已抓获", ...}
      ]
    }
  }
}

The meta_timeline clearly contains unrelated content about a different news event.

Solution

Set meta_timeline to null for entry ID 1022, which is the correct state when no finer-grained timeline exists for a particular event. This ensures data consistency across the dataset.

Changes

  1. data/gold_reference.jsonl: Fixed line 503 by setting meta_timeline: null
  2. .gitignore: Added standard Python .gitignore to prevent committing build artifacts
  3. Cleanup: Removed accidentally committed __pycache__ files

Verification

  • ✅ All 543 lines remain valid JSON
  • ✅ Line 503 now has correct structure with meta_timeline: null
  • ✅ Line 502 (which correctly has a meta_timeline about the 叶洪青 case) remains unchanged
  • ✅ Main timeline content is intact and unmodified
  • ✅ File size reduced by 1,185 bytes (removed incorrect data)

This fix prevents potential issues when training or evaluating timeline summarization models that rely on the consistency between main timelines and their meta_timelines.

Closes #[issue_number]

Warning

Firewall rules blocked me from connecting to one or more addresses (expand for details)

I tried to connect to the following addresses, but was blocked by firewall rules:

  • github.com (HTTP Only)
    • Triggering command: /usr/bin/ssh -o SendEnv=GIT_PROTOCOL git@github.com git-upload-pack '/half-pie/half-json.git' (packet block)

If you need me to access, download, or install something from one of these locations, you can either:

Original prompt

This section details on the original issue you should resolve

<issue_title>a possible annotation error in your dataset</issue_title>
<issue_description>I’ve already understood the role of mate_timeline. My earlier confusion stems from a possible annotation error in your dataset: please check line 503 in data/gold_reference.jsonl , where the timeline appears to be mismatched.

{"title": "金晓钟金泫雅恋情", "id": 1022, "timeline": [{"id": 0, "time": "2018-08-02T00:00:00+00:00", "summary": "泫雅金晓钟公布恋情:已交往两年", "atoms": ["泫雅金晓钟公布恋情", "泫雅和金晓钟交往两年"]}, {"id": 1, "time": "2018-09-13T00:00:00+00:00", "summary": "泫雅金晓钟公开恋爱后被公司辞退", "atoms": ["泫雅金晓钟公开恋爱", "公司辞退泫雅金晓钟"]}, {"id": 2, "time": "2018-10-12T00:00:00+00:00", "summary": "金泫雅金晓钟公开后首次合体亮相", "atoms": ["金泫雅公开合体亮相", "金晓钟公开合体亮相"]}, {"id": 3, "time": "2020-09-19T00:00:00+00:00", "summary": "金晓钟:泫雅是自己最后一任女友", "atoms": ["金晓钟是泫雅女友"]}, {"id": 4, "time": "2021-03-19T00:00:00+00:00", "summary": "泫雅金晓钟自曝算命结果", "atoms": ["泫雅自曝算命结果", "金晓钟自曝算命结果"]}, {"id": 5, "time": "2021-08-16T00:00:00+00:00", "summary": "泫雅金晓钟将合体出道", "atoms": ["泫雅将与金晓钟合体出道"]}, {"id": 6, "time": "2022-02-04T00:00:00+00:00", "summary": "金泫雅答应金晓钟求婚", "atoms": ["金泫雅答应金晓钟求婚"]}, {"id": 7, "time": "2022-11-30T00:00:00+00:00", "summary": "泫雅金晓钟宣布分手:以后只是好朋友跟同事", "atoms": ["泫雅金晓钟宣布分手", "泫雅金晓钟以后只是好朋友跟同事"]}, {"id": 8, "time": "2022-12-01T00:00:00+00:00", "summary": "金晓钟回应与泫雅分手:即使分手,今后也是我最爱的艺人", "atoms": ["金晓钟回应与泫雅分手", "金晓钟最爱泫雅"]}], "meta_timeline": {"5": {"title": "金晓钟金泫雅恋情", "id": 1022, "timeline": [{"id": 0, "time": "2021-07-13T00:00:00+00:00", "summary": "杞县公安局通报:村民叶洪青被打死 犯罪嫌疑人已抓获", "atoms": ["杞县公安局通报村民叶洪青被打死", "犯罪嫌疑人已被抓获"]}, {"id": 1, "time": "2022-12-05T00:00:00+00:00", "summary": "叶洪青女儿实名举报:父亲被打死 打人者至今逍遥法外", "atoms": ["叶洪青的女儿实名举报父亲被打死", "打人者至今逍遥法外"]}, {"id": 2, "time": "2022-12-06T00:00:00+00:00", "summary": "网传实名举报女孩被七八名男子强行带走 至今失联", "atoms": ["女孩被七八名男子强行带走", "女孩至今失联"]}, {"id": 3, "time": "2022-12-08T00:00:00+00:00", "summary": "杞县警方:女孩在公安局,涉嫌违法犯罪,正在调查中", "atoms": ["女孩在公安局", "女孩涉嫌违法犯罪", "警方正在调查女孩"]}, {"id": 4, "time": "2022-12-20T00:00:00+00:00", "summary": "河南女子举报父亲被打死一案宣判 主犯被判无期徒刑", "atoms": ["河南女子举报父亲被打死一案", "主犯被判无期徒刑"]}], "meta_timeline": null}}} </issue_description>

Comments on the Issue (you are @copilot in this section)

@chenlong-clock Thank you for your careful inspection of our dataset, we've noticed the bug and will fix it soon

Fixes #4


💡 You can make Copilot smarter by setting up custom instructions, customizing its development environment and configuring Model Context Protocol (MCP) servers. Learn more Copilot coding agent tips in the docs.

Copilot AI and others added 2 commits October 9, 2025 16:42
Co-authored-by: chenlong-clock <77712760+chenlong-clock@users.noreply.github.com>
Co-authored-by: chenlong-clock <77712760+chenlong-clock@users.noreply.github.com>
Copilot AI changed the title [WIP] Fix possible annotation error in dataset Fix annotation error in gold_reference.jsonl line 503 Oct 9, 2025
Copilot AI requested a review from chenlong-clock October 9, 2025 16:47
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

a possible annotation error in your dataset

2 participants